Latest Patents

Timothy holds a patent for a "Weld metal material apparatus and method." This invention involves a solid weld-metal-producing material formed by agglomerating weld metal material powder. The design includes an igniter that may be integrally formed in or on the agglomerated weld metal material. The mixture not only contains typical components such as a reductant metal and a transition metal oxide but may also include a binder material like sodium silicate. This binder aids in holding the agglomerated material together and enhances the exothermic reaction during ignition.
